SB 5935 - 2017-18
Enhancing consumer access, affordability, and quality of broadband and advanced telecommunications services.
Sponsors: Sheldon, Carlyle
Bill History

2017 1ST SPECIAL SESSION

May 5
First reading, referred to Energy, Environment & Telecommunications. (View Original Bill)

2017 2ND SPECIAL SESSION

May 23
By resolution, reintroduced and retained in present status.

2017 3RD SPECIAL SESSION

Jun 21
By resolution, reintroduced and retained in present status.
Nov 14
Public hearing in the Senate Committee on Energy, Environment & Telecommunications at 10: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
2017 INTERIM - Public hearing in the Senate Committee on Energy and Environment & Telecommunications at 10:00 AM.

2018 REGULAR SESSION

Jan 8
By resolution, reintroduced and retained in present status.
Due to Senate committee reorganization, referred to Energy, Environment & Technology.
Jan 25
Public hearing in the Senate Committee on Energy, Environment & Technology at 10: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
Feb 1
Executive action taken in the Senate Committee on Energy, Environment & Technology at 10: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
EENT - Majority; 1st substitute bill be substituted, do pass. (View 1st Substitute) (Majority Report)
And refer to Ways & Means.
Feb 2
Referred to Ways & Means.
Feb 5
Public hearing in the Senate Committee on Ways & Means at 10: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
Feb 6
Executive action taken in the Senate Committee on Ways & Means at 10: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
WM - Majority; 2nd substitute bill be substituted, do pass. (View 2nd Substitute) (Majority Report)
Minority; without recommendation. (Minority Report)
Passed to Rules Committee for second reading.
Feb 8
Placed on second reading by Rules Committee.
Feb 10
2nd substitute bill substituted (WM 18). (View 2nd Substitute)
Held on calendar.
Feb 14
Floor amendment(s) adopted.
Rules suspended. Placed on Third Reading.
Third reading, passed; yeas, 45; nays, 3; absent, 0; excused, 1. (View 1st Engrossed) (View Roll Calls)

IN THE HOUSE

Feb 16
First reading, referred to Technology & Economic Development (Not Officially read and referred until adoption of Introduction report).
Feb 22
Public hearing in the House Committee on Technology & Economic Development at 1:30 PM. (Committee Materials)
Mar 1
Executive action taken in the House Committee on Technology & Economic Development at 8: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
TED - Majority; do pass with amendment(s). (Majority Report)
Referred to Appropriations.
Mar 3
Public hearing and executive action taken in the House Committee on Appropriations at 9: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
APP - Majority; do pass with amendment(s) by Technology & Economic Development. (Majority Report)
Minority; do not pass. (Minority Report)
Minority; without recommendation. (Minority Report)
Mar 5
Placed on second reading.
Mar 8
By resolution, returned to Senate Rules Committee for third reading.
